What Does a Home Care Assistant Do?
A home care assistant helps with daily tasks that might become harder as someone gets older. This can include bathing, dressing, brushing teeth, preparing meals, and light housekeeping. These are called personal care services for seniors, and they’re essential for staying safe and healthy at home.
But personal care assistants do more than just help with routines. They offer companionship, encouragement, and peace of mind. They’re the ones who notice changes in behavior, eating habits, or mobility, and often act as a gentle link between the client and their family. What Physical Therapy Brings to the Table
Physical therapy, on the other hand, focuses on helping someone recover strength, balance, and movement. This service is usually prescribed after a surgery, illness, or fall. A licensed therapist leads exercises and tracks progress with the goal of improving mobility and reducing the risk of future injuries.
While physical therapy is usually time-limited (lasting for a few weeks or months), its benefits can last much longer, especially when paired with consistent personal care assistance. Once therapy sessions are done, a home care assistant can help the senior continue safe movement and stick with helpful habits.

When Physical Therapy Is a Must
Physical therapy is most often recommended after a fall, stroke, surgery, or illness that affects movement. It’s also valuable for those with arthritis, Parkinson’s disease, or other conditions that affect balance and coordination.
Therapists bring medical training that personal care assistants don’t offer. But they’re also focused on short-term recovery. Once therapy ends, having a caregiver step in to maintain safe mobility can help protect those gains and avoid future injuries.
